福勒氏杆菌及其伴胞体。

Fowler's bacillus and its parasporal body.

作者信息

HANNAY C L

出版信息

J Biophys Biochem Cytol. 1961 Feb;9(2):285-98. doi: 10.1083/jcb.9.2.285.

DOI:10.1083/jcb.9.2.285
PMID:13711279
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C2224995/
Abstract

Fowler's bacillus is one of several organisms which form a non-viable inclusion or parasporal body during the process of sporulation. This body is globular and may be as large as or larger than the spore. Its position in the cell is not random; the spore is terminal and the body paracentral, lying between the spore and the remaining vegetative cell chromatin bodies. On completion of sporulation both spore and body are contained within an exosporium. The sequence in the development of the cell structures was followed in ultrathin sections of material fixed in permanganate. When sporulation is well advanced the body begins to grow from a single crystal, then presumably as a result of some disorientation in the growth process it develops as a multicrystalline body with the lattices orientated at different angles. When the body approximates the spore in size, a lamella coat is formed and an exosporium develops which eventually encircles the body and the spore. Other lamella systems microscopically similar to those surrounding the parasporal body develop free in the cytoplasm outside the exosporium. In both of these systems the number of lamellae is variable. The spore coat of Fowler's bacillus, consisting of an outer lamella layer and an inner unresolved amorphous layer has been found microscopically identical to the spore coat of B. cereus. In both organisms the lamella layer of the spore coat consists, in contrast to the other lamella systems, of a regular number of lamellae. Physiological tests would indicate that Fowler's bacillus is a variety of B. cereus.

摘要

福勒氏芽孢杆菌是在芽孢形成过程中形成无活力包涵体或伴孢体的几种生物体之一。这个体是球形的,可能与孢子一样大或比孢子更大。它在细胞中的位置不是随机的;孢子是末端的,而体是近中心的,位于孢子和其余营养细胞染色质体之间。芽孢形成完成后,孢子和体都包含在芽孢外壁内。在经高锰酸盐固定的材料的超薄切片中追踪了细胞结构的发育顺序。当芽孢形成充分进展时,体开始从单晶生长,然后大概由于生长过程中的一些取向紊乱,它发展为多晶体,其晶格以不同角度取向。当体在大小上接近孢子时,形成一层薄片包膜,并且芽孢外壁发育,最终包围体和孢子。其他在显微镜下与围绕伴孢体的那些相似的薄片系统在芽孢外壁外的细胞质中自由发育。在这两个系统中,薄片的数量是可变的。福勒氏芽孢杆菌的芽孢衣由外层薄片层和内层未分辨的无定形层组成,在显微镜下已发现与蜡状芽孢杆菌的芽孢衣相同。在这两种生物体中,与其他薄片系统相比,芽孢衣的薄片层由规则数量的薄片组成。生理测试表明福勒氏芽孢杆菌是蜡状芽孢杆菌的一个变种。
